Here is a list of the influences from most to least.

1.Hermit
2.Hegemony
3.Dominator
4.Superpower
5.Power
6.Powerbroker
7.Eminence Grise
8.Enforcer
9.Dealmaker
10.Instigator
11.Contender
12.Negotiator
13.Auxiliary
14.Ambassador
15.Diplomat
16.Envoy
17.Duckspeaker
18.Handshaker
19.Truckler
20.Vassal
21.Minnow

In my region, I'm a Contender. Using almost all my influence, I'd be able to eject and ban an Eminence Grise. I'd guess I'd have to be an Instigator or a Dealmaker to eject and ban both an Eminence Grise and an Envoy.

If it's only ejecting, it's a different story. Ejecting an Eminence Grise uses about half of my influence, so I'd guess either diplomat or ambassador to only eject both.
